Analysis

The most recent figure for net bilateral aid flows from dac donors, korea, rep. (current us$) in Upper middle income is 601.87 million current US$,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 19.5% on the previous year and up 285.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, net bilateral aid flows from dac donors, korea, rep. (current us$) in Upper middle income peaked at 601.87 million current US$ in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0 current US$, in 1960.

That places Upper middle income 14th out of 46 groups with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ated

Net bilateral aid flows from DAC donors, Korea, Rep. (current US$) with 352 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
